As for why it is a good preparation system. It isn't, by itself, a good preparation system. It is part of what Research thinks is a good strategy that should help ALD in the long run.

This is part of Operation Hades, as described on the /r/EliteLavigny sub-reddit.

To this point, every power has played the same game - rapidly eating up all profitable expansions as quickly as possible. As of now, that is no longer a valid means of moving forward. We have reached the end of the road. It's time to carve out our own way forward.

A successful expansion in Mbutsi for ALD Contests 79cc worth of Exploited systems for Winters. This effectively removes -79cc out of their income. We've been terming it an 'evil prep' in strategy discussions.

The Lavigny-Duval power base is already operating at a -300cc standing-deficit. We have tried multiple times to shed our worst deficit-causing systems, while retaining the profit-making ones. This is why when we did fortify every single system, our enemies did not even have to undermine all of our systems to push us into deficit.

To date, we have only lost 3 out of around 14 deficit-causing control systems, with that number growing every week. This week, we have 3 deficit-causing expansions, and they are all well over their expansion trigger. There is no means of removing systems from our rolls, except with enemy action. The secondary benefit of the 'evil prep' strategy is to attempt to force our enemies to undermine us two weeks in a row, thus giving us a chance to lose our deficit-causing systems, in particular those systems which are never fortified.

If you collected merit vouchers from undermining or combat zones, you need to turn them in at a Lavigny-Duval Control System. The bonus/salary does not come until your second week with the Power. Your salary comes from the Rating you have when you started the week. On Thursday, you will either have no salary or a Rating 1 salary, I'm unsure, but you will start next week with Rating 5, which will earn you the 50 million bonus/salary next week.
